闽北山区竹林分布及动态变化的地形分异特征研究 被引量:4

摘要 地形是影响植被分布和变化的重要因素之一,摸清竹资源的地形分异特征,对制定区域的竹资源可持续发展和生态环境建设战略具有重要意义。以福建省顺昌县为例,在GIS和遥感技术的支持下,结合遥感数据成图与地形因子叠加分析,对竹林分布及动态变化的地形分异特征进行了研究。研究结果表明:①竹林主要分布在海拔1 200m以下,400~800m区域竹林面积最大,在海拔800m以下随着海拔的升高,竹林面积逐渐增大,在海拔800m以上,随着海拔的升高竹林面积逐渐减少;②竹林集中分布在坡度6~25°区域,并且主要分布在半阳坡和半阴坡;③从1988~2007年间顺昌县竹林面积呈快速增长态势,净增加面积为1 6811.48hm2;增加、减少和未变3种变化类型中,增加和未变的竹林面积随地形的变化呈先增加后减少的趋势;而减少的竹林面积随着海拔升高逐渐减少,随着坡度的变化先升高后减少,并且在各个坡向上变化不大。研究成果反映了自然与人为驱动力对顺昌县竹林面积的动态变化的影响,为该县竹林利用规划和生态建设提供了科学依据。 Terrain is an important factor for affecting the distribution and vegetation changes. It is very important that formulates regional sustainable development of bamboo resources and ecological environment construction strategy by finding out the topographic Variation characteristics of bamboo resources. Fujian Shunchang is taken as an example in this paper,combined with remote sensing data and overlay analysis of terrain factor,the distribution of bamboo and dynamic change of terrain were studied by GIS and remote sensing. The results show that bamboo is mainly located at the areas where the sea level altitude is less than 1 200 m, the largest area of bamboo is concentrated in the area where the sea level altitude is from 400 m to 800 m,the bamboo area enlarged with the increasing of altitude when the sea level altitude is less than 800m, and the bamboo forest area is gradually reduced with the elevation of altitude when the sea level altitude is over 800 m; The bamboo is mainly located at the areas of which the slope is 6-25°,and mainly located in the semi-sunny and semi shaded regions. The bamboo area is rapidly growing from 1988 to 2007 in Shunchang,and the increasing area is 16 811.48 hm^2. The result reflects the dynamic area of bamboo in Shunchang which is affected by the natural and man-made driving forces,and the result provides a scientific basis for planning and ecological construction.
